Output caf91029ea0e682b72cfd7d2eb6f3c311160c4c9aa786bbb104ac5f458795164:0

value
1263739
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f7dd996db28e7e1a61240868c56c9496176c81a3 OP_EQUAL
address
3QHcHv9tBw58pmMEVjKZ5CywDpmV3KF8nA
transaction
caf91029ea0e682b72cfd7d2eb6f3c311160c4c9aa786bbb104ac5f458795164
confirmations
160024
spent
true